British Summer Time

I manage three different Fortigates (200, 800 & 1000) running 5.2.2 all are time sync'd using NTP (uk.pool.ntp.org) and all set to the GMT timezone. However since British Summer Time kicked in all three clocks are an hour behind. I've checked DST is enabled under global config but this setting makes no difference whether it's enabled or disabled.

 

Just realised there are two GMT's in the selection box, the one with London in accommodates BST!
